NHTSA Campaign 20V082000

SEATS

Filed by Jaguar Land Rover North America, LLC.

NHTSA campaign 20V082000 covers 1 vehicle and concerns the seats. The repair is free.

What this recall covers

The defect
Jaguar Land Rover North America, LLC (Jaguar) is recalling one 2020 I-Pace vehicle. The front passenger seat frame may be missing fasteners, resulting in a seat frame with insufficient strength.
The risk
In the event of a crash, the seat may not properly secure the occupant, increasing their risk of injury.
The fix
Jaguar will notify the owner, and a dealer will replace the front passenger seat assembly, free of charge. The recall began March 25, 2020. Owners may contact Jaguar customer service at 1-800-452-4827. Jaguar's number for this recall is H282.

Is my car affected?

Being on this list means your year, make and model fall inside campaign 20V082000. It does not mean your individual car does: a campaign covers a range of VINs built in a specific window, and cars either side of that window are untouched.

Check the 17-character VIN from the driver-side dashboard or door jamb against NHTSA's lookup. If it is covered, the dealer must do the work free of charge, regardless of the car's age or mileage.
